[6:11] My name's Sandy Fall, and God gave me a special gift to help animals, and I'm lucky enough to be on this planet to help some animals. I've been a non-profit, no-kill animal shelter, licensed for 35 years now as a rescue.
[6:30] This little goat right here was born blind and almost dead. The vet didn't figure she'd make it six hours. For the first month of his life he slept next to my bed.
[6:42] He's four months now. Her name is Patton. She was born, and her mother wouldn't take care of her. Her brother died, so now she's Miracle's best friend.
[6:54] We burned down five years ago, and Pete here actually pulled me out of the fire. And we're still rebuilding here. The church was amazing with donations. We got help here after the fire.
[7:05] It was amazing. People all came to our house. 100% of every penny we get here goes to the animals.
[7:16] And like I say, it costs about $100 a day just for food for Donnick the Barn. The only way we survive now is with volunteers. Good morning.

[28:11] I want oatmeal I want bacon and eggs that's a choice so if God only gave us the choice of good and that's all he created we wouldn't be like him we wouldn't truly be made in the image of God we'd be kind of a false shadow of God so he gave us a real choice it was a possibility and then people gave it life the one thing we were told not to do we did it now why am I saying we because we are children of Adam and every one of us start out in that innocence that beauty that wonder that joy of being like little children with no understanding at all of what sin is until one day we come to understand good and evil and what do we do even though we know we shouldn't we choose to do evil we choose sin now sin by the way in the writings of Paul come in two different types one is sin with a small s and the other is sin with a big s now it doesn't actually show up that way in the book you got to figure this out sin with a small s is when we say I sinned today
[29:39] I did some action that was wrong as compared to sin with a big s which Paul uses to describe a power a force that we've unleashed in the world that brings brokenness and chaos and destruction so when we chose to do that small sin small s sin we unleashed the power of evil and the truth of the matter is it destroyed everything we talk about Satan like he's evil but you know he was created as the angel of light did you know that that's his name Lucifer the angel of light his job was to shine light on the faithfulness of humanity point out how we were so faithful and loving to God and when we reached for that fruit we brought down the entire universe Romans chapter 8 says all creation groans and is waiting for the day of restoration it's wrong and we do it and we all sin we all make that choice that's original sin that we all have it as part of our character that we give in to sin

[38:13] God the Holy Spirit of God breathed into us transformed everything and made us alive the presence of God sin brings brokenness between us and God sin makes a separation between us and God and in the process it also means that we're separated from life sin sin causes us to die from our separation and brokenness with God so we understand sin is bad and by the way it's not just the sins of commission the ones we do but it's also the sins of omission the good we don't do and it's even the ones that we don't really know are wrong John Wesley used to define sin and he said sin properly so called are the things that you know are wrong and you do anything anyways like sticking your finger in the fire why do you do that eating the fruit but sometimes we also do things that are wrong and we don't know it anybody else have that
[39:23] I've had many times where people point out to me things I'm doing wrong now John Wesley would call those defects we're defective I like that we're all defective and fall short of the glory of God that's easy because we can blame him again right it's not our fault well it doesn't matter Wesley would say to us and it's true that that brokenness still requires grace it requires God to fix it whether it's sin properly called or sin that we don't even understand it creates a separation from God and leads to death and the sins of the many of all of us are the brokenness we live in because sin infects all of us just as through the disobedience of the one man the many were made sinners we're all sinners it says on the other hand through the one man so also through the obedience of the one man
